What is the production process for manganese copper resistors?
Manganese copper resistor is a common electronic component, whose main function is to limit current. In circuits, manganese copper resistors are widely used to control the magnitude of current and protect other electronic components. So, what is the production process for manganese copper resistors?
Firstly, the manufacturing of manganese copper resistors requires the use of two metal materials, manganese and copper. These two materials require a series of preparation processes to produce suitable manganese copper resistors. During the preparation process, manufacturers need to choose different material ratios and process parameters based on different resistance values and specification requirements.
Next, the production of manganese copper resistors requires some special equipment and tools. For example, manufacturers need to use equipment such as resistance wire machines, resistance furnaces, and resistance wire drawing machines to manufacture resistance wires, and then bend the resistance wires mechanically or manually to create the desired resistance shape.
In the production process, in order to ensure the quality and performance of manganese copper resistors, manufacturers need to conduct a series of inspections and tests. For example, multiple tests such as resistance value testing, temperature coefficient testing, withstand voltage testing, and temperature change testing are required to ensure that the manganese copper resistance meets relevant standards and specifications.
Overall, the production process of manganese copper resistors is relatively complex and requires manufacturers to have rich experience and technology. Only by strictly controlling every step of the manufacturing process can high-quality manganese copper resistors be produced.
